admin 管理员组

文章数量: 887021


2024年1月18日发(作者:亚太版switch)

MyBatis 是一个流行的Java持久层框架,它提供了简单的API,可以实现数据库的交互。在MyBatis中,如果你需要对字符串进行子字符串解析,通常会使用Java的`String`类提供的`substring()`方法。

以下是如何在MyBatis中使用`substring()`方法的示例:

1. 首先,在MyBatis的映射文件()中定义SQL查询,并在需要截取字符串的地方使用`substring()`函数:

```xml

```

在这个例子中,`columnName`是要截取的字符串列,`startIndex`是开始截取的位置(从0开始计数),`length`是要截取的字符串长度。

2. 然后在MyBatis的配置文件()中配置这个映射器:

```xml

```

3. 最后,在你的Java代码中调用这个查询:

```java

SqlSession sqlSession = ssion();

try {

YourMapper mapper = per();

List results = Substring();

// 处理查询结果

} finally {

();

}

```

请确保`YourResultType`是一个能够处理截取的字符串类型的类,例如一个字符串字段。


本文标签: 字符串 截取 查询 处理 需要